We are definitely not new to chickens. We started with just a few and then began trying different breeds. Our local farm store offered a variety of different breeds. We have our favorites.

We currently have about 30 birds, one pen has a barnyard mixture, another has Sapphire Gems, and another with Speckled Sussix.

Raising backyard chickens is a great hobby. We are actually moving into producing birds for future consumption and sales. We are pleased with not having to buy eggs from the grocery store, and are looking forward to organically growing birds that will be pasture fed and maybe someday we will sell them.

One thing that I really enjoy is learning to automate some of the daily tasks that will make raising chickens a little more efficient. Figuring out an automatic watering system for example.

Upscaling our bird production and finding some income possibilites was actually my sons idea. He and his family live on our ranch and we have grandkids that love the animals. We also produce an amazing garden every year, and do hydroponic gardening that gives us fresh greens year round.
